Output f3674b86d6ddf2dafefb8ab69b0618a476aec8f8609065968b7e4a819213f661:1

value
427714361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c881a378be358929082cf0dab65ffbfa02670ee OP_EQUAL
address
37D5WccVX8NCYyd3e2wtqP76TCiBt3HmWw
transaction
f3674b86d6ddf2dafefb8ab69b0618a476aec8f8609065968b7e4a819213f661
spent
true